Position: HVAC Project & Start-Up Technician


This position is ideal for an experienced HVAC professional who enjoys installing, commissioning, troubleshooting, and ensuring commercial HVAC systems operate at peak performance.

As an HVAC Project and Start-Up Technician, you will play a critical role in bringing new and retrofit HVAC projects online while maintaining the highest standards of quality, safety, and customer service.


Key Responsibilities:

  • Install, maintain, and troubleshoot commercial HVAC systems
  • Perform equipment start-up, testing, and commissioning
  • Work with Hydronic, Steam, Chilled  Water, DX, Forced Air, Heat Pump, VAV, Constant Volume, Exhaust, Heat Recovery, and Sheet Metal Duct Systems
  • Diagnose and resolve HVAC and mechanical system issues
  • Perform preventive maintenance on  HVAC equipment
  • Verify proper system operation and  performance during start-up activities
  • Calculate and apply CFM, BTU, HR,  GPM, PSI, and duct sizing requirements
  • Follow project installation drawings, specifications, and procedures
  • Maintain accurate project  documentation and records
  • Ensure compliance with all safety  regulations and PPE requirements
  • Maintain tools, equipment, and  materials necessary for project success
  • Work collaboratively with customers,  vendors, and fellow team members

Requirements

 Required Qualifications:

  • Experience with commercial HVAC  installation, start-up, or service work
  • Strong understanding of electrical schematics
  • Knowledge of refrigeration cycles and HVAC system operation
  • Basic understanding of DDC controls
  • Experience operating hand and power tools safely
  • Ability to solder, braze, and weld
  • Strong communication and teamwork  skills
  • Ability to read and interpret plans,  diagrams, and specifications

Physical Requirements:

  • Ability to lift up to 50 pounds
  • Ability to work on ladders,  scaffolding, elevated platforms, and boom lifts
  • Ability to climb, bend, kneel, twist,  push, pull, and stand for extended periods
  • Flexibility to work early mornings,  evenings, or extended shifts as project schedules require
